F lourishing is a wonderful word. I first encountered it during my philosophy classes, while discussing its Greek translation, eudaimonia (εὐδαιμονία). The Greek word can also be loosely translated as happiness or welfare . As Aristotle says : [Ch 9] …Happiness (eudaimonia) comes to one by means of virtue and some sort of learning or training… [Ch 5] virtues are neither feelings nor predispositions…they are active conditions (hexis).
